The Soaked Lamb is a band of roots music with strong influences of pre-warblues and jazz. The band was formed in 2006 and it¹s composed of sixmembers. Miguel Lima plays reco-reco, that idiophone instrument that soundsgreat due to the friction of a small stick on a piece of bamboo. He alsoplays an actual musical instrument: drums. Vasco Condessa plays every key ofthe piano. Gito is responsible for the lower notes. He¹s able to playupright bass like any other good performer, but with less strings. Both Gitoand Vasco spend their days, when they¹re not playing, working in advertisingas a consuming hobby. Afonso Cruz  a director and illustrator that brewshis own beer  plays guitar, blues harp, ukulele and banjo. He also singsand writes the lyrics and songs. Sometimes he wears a mustache, sometimes hedoesn¹t. The main vocals are the responsibility of Mariana Lima, one of themost feminine members of the band. Her voice brings memories over seventyyears old and lyrics often written in iambic pentameters (or so). TiagoAlbuquerque plays sax, clarinet, guitar and concertina, and because his daysare longer, he also illustrates and directs animation movies. He uses --like all the other members of the band, except for one -- a hat.The first CD was recorded on Sundays, calmly during a whole year. During thesessions a typical Portuguese recipe of soaked lamb was served, hence thename of the band. If you listen carefully, you can actually notice the songsrecorded with a breath scent of cumin, wine and mint. $21.05 Funkadelic's 1974 release STANDING ON THE VERGE OF GETTING IT ON proved to be a continuation of the more consolidated direction laid down on its predecessor, COSMIC SLOP. But STANDING is the better and stronger album, and easily Funkadelic's most consistent work since the classic MAGGOT BRAIN. Even though the band's members were, at the time, doing double duty in the more commercially oriented Parliament, Funkadelic maintained its complete allegiance here to wildly experimental, rock-influenced music.
The album begins with a lighthearted poem read by two band members, their voices sped up to sound like The Chipmunks. This leads directly into the vicious funk-rock of "Red Hot Mama" and the absolutely raging rocker, "Alice In My Fantasies." The mood calms down briefly for the soulful "I'll Stay" and the playful pop of "Sexy Ways." There are jazzy moments ("Jimmy's Got A Little Bit Of Bitch In Him"), and meditative instrumentals ("Good Thoughts, Bad Thoughts"), but the topper is the title track, a manically exuberant jam that still ranks among P-funk's greatest moments.
Expanding back out to a more all-over-the-place lineup -- about 15 or so people this time out -- Funkadelic got a bit more back on track with Standing on the Verge. Admittedly, George Clinton repeats a trick from America Eats Its Young via another re-recording of an Osmium track, namely leadoff cut "Red Hot Mama." However, starting as it does with a hilarious double soliloquy (with the first voice sounding like the happier brother of Sir Nose d'Voidoffunk) and coming across with a fierce new take, it's a good omen for Standing on the Verge as a whole. Eddie Hazel's guitar work in particular is just plain bad-ass; after his absence from Cosmic Slop, it's good to hear him fully back in action with Bernie Worrell, Cordell Mosson, Gary Shider, and the rest. In general, compared to the sometimes too polite Cosmic Slop, Standing on the Verge is a full-bodied, crazy mess in the best possible way, with heavy funk jams that still smoke today while making a lot of supposedly loud and dangerous rock sound anemic.
